Yucatan Feast Multicolor Hand Woven Cotton Hammock Double Size _artisan--novica-artisan-8441 Due to the handmade natureMaya Artists of the Yucatn weave shades of yellow, blue, orange, green, and pink into a bright and comfortable hammock. Artisans preserve the traditional hand weaving techniques first developed by Maya ancestors to craft this inviting hammock. Long before the Spanish arrived upon the coasts of the Yucatan Peninsula, the Maya preferred to sleep and rest in hammocks.
